ZHCSUJ5A March 2025 – December 2025 TPS1689
PRODUCTION DATA
ALERT_MASK 是一条制造商特定命令,用于配置或读取允许将 SMBA 信号置为有效的事件。
此命令使用 PMBus® 读取字或写入字协议。
每个位对应一个模拟和数字故障或警告,这些故障或警告通常会导致 SMBA 置为有效。当相应位为高电平时,该情况不会导致 SMBA 置为有效。如果该情况发生,记录该状态的寄存器(状态寄存器和黑盒寄存器)仍会正常更新,且器件的开/关控制功能依然有效。此子命令的详细信息如表 8-67 中所示。
| 位 | 名称 | 值 | 说明 | 默认值 | 访问 |
|---|---|---|---|---|---|
15:9 | 保留 | 0000000 | 保留 | 0000000 | 读取/写入 |
8 | 未知 | 1 | UNKNOWN 状态位不会将 SMBA 置为有效 | 1 | |
0 | UNKNOWN 状态位置为有效 SMBA | ||||
7 | PGOODB | 1 | PGOOD 下降不会将 SMBA 置为有效 | 0 | |
0 | PGOOD 下降将 SMBA 置为有效 | ||||
6 | GLBL_FLT | 1 | GLBL_FLT 不会将 SMBA 置为有效 | 0 | |
0 | GLBL_FLT 将 SMBA 置为有效 | ||||
5 | MFR_STATUS | 1 | STATUS_MFR_SPECIFIC 寄存器中设置的有效位不会将 SMBA 置为有效 | 0 | |
0 | STATUS_MFR_SPECIFIC 寄存器中设置的有效位将 SMBA 置为有效 | ||||
4 | STATUS_TEMP | 1 | STATUS_TEMP 寄存器中设置的有效位不会将 SMBA 置为有效 | 0 | |
0 | STATUS_TEMP 寄存器中设置的有效位将 SMBA 置为有效 | ||||
3 | STATUS_OUT | 1 | STATUS_OUT 寄存器中设置的有效位不会将 SMBA 置为有效 | 0 | |
0 | STATUS_OUT 寄存器中设置的有效位将 SMBA 置为有效 | ||||
2 | STATUS_IN | 1 | STATUS_INPUT 寄存器中设置的有效位不会将 SMBA 置为有效 | 0 | |
0 | STATUS_INPUT 寄存器中设置的有效位会置为有效 SMBA | ||||
1 | CML_ERR | 1 | STATUS_CML 寄存器中设置的有效位不会将 SMBA 置为有效 | 0 | |
0 | STATUS_CML 寄存器中设置的有效位将 SMBA 置为有效 | ||||
0 | STATUS_IOUT | 1 | STATUS_IOUT 寄存器中设置的有效位不会将 SMBA 置为有效 | 0 | |
0 | STATUS_IOUT 寄存器中设置的有效位将 SMBA 置为有效 |
向此寄存器执行写入命令前,应先发送 MFR_WRITE_PROTECT 命令以解锁器件,防止意外或误触发的写入。
GLBL_FLT 是 FAULT_MASK 寄存器中未被屏蔽的状态位的逻辑“或”结果。